Abstract

1,043,863. Boots &c. BRITISH UNITED SHOE MACHINERY CO. Ltd. (UNITED SHOE MACHINERY CORPORATION). May 17, 1963 [May 18, 1962], No. 19187/62. Heading A3B. A machine for shaping heel end portions of shoe uppers off the last comprises a plate having a peripheral contour corresponding to the heel end of an insole; a support for the plate and members arranged on opposite sides of the plate defining a cross-sectional contour heightwise of a shoe upper supported on the plate. As described the above features are incorporated in a heel seat lasting machine of the type described in Specifications 473,129 and 473,197. The plate 40 (Fig. 8) is mounted on a support 48 carried by a jack 32 and has resiliently mounted pins 54 to position the insole. The plate also carries an inner form 68 (Fig. 5, not shown) for shaping the region of the back line of the upper, the angle between the form 68 and the plate 40 being adjusted by a knurled nut 74 and a screw 78. The cross-sectional contour of the upper is defined by two members 82 (Fig. 8) which are pivotally mounted on the support 48 and which are urged into notches in the plate 40 by a spring 88. The members 82 form the inner jaws of grippers which have outer jaws 92 which are closed by piston and cylinders 100 to clamp the upper in position before the jack 32 is moved from its work receiving position as shown in Fig. 5 to its operative position. The heel band 202 (Fig. 13 not shown) is clamped against the heel end of an upper by a steel band 246 which applies pressure to the heel band 202 through a resilient spacer 204. The heel band is closed about the upper by means of a piston and cylinder 260 via double armed levers 252, 254 and links 250. In operation the operator places an upper (complete with lining and stiffener) and insole on the plate 40 with the jack 32 in its work receiving position (Fig. 5) and depresses a treadle (not shown) to operate the grippers 92 and clamp the upper in position. Further depression of the treadle causes the jack 32 to move from its work receiving position to its operative position and to move heightwise until the insole contacts a hold-down member 174 (Fig. 3 not shown). The heel band is closed about the upper by operation of a hand lever (not shown). The machine then operates as described in Specification 473,197 to wipe the lasting margin, apply bedding pressure against the wipers, tack the lasting margin to the insole and then return the various parts to their initial position.
